;The Senate has intervened on the protracted standoff at the Machakos County Assembly that followed an impeachment motion against the house speaker Anne Kiusya. A letter dated May 20th, 2025, from the clerk of the Senate Jeremiah Nyegenye summons the speaker, Members of the County Assembly and key Assembly officials to appear before the Senate Standing Committee on Devolution and Intergovernmental Relations on Tuesday next week and explain the indefinite suspension of the House sittings.
